The Importance Of BS 8524 Fire Curtain For Building Safety

In recent years, there has been a growing concern about fire safety in buildings, especially in high-rise structures The tragic events such as the Grenfell Tower fire in 2017 have brought to light the importance of having proper fire safety measures in place to protect both lives and properties One of the key components of fire safety in buildings is the installation of fire curtains, and the BS 8524 standard sets out the requirements for these crucial safety systems.

A fire curtain is a specially designed curtain made of fire-resistant material that deploys automatically in the event of a fire Its primary purpose is to compartmentalize the fire, preventing its spread to other parts of the building and allowing occupants more time to evacuate safely Fire curtains are typically installed in areas where traditional fire doors or walls are impractical, such as large open spaces or atriums.

The BS 8524 standard was introduced to ensure that fire curtains are manufactured, installed, and maintained to a high standard, providing reliable fire protection when needed This standard specifies the requirements for fire curtain assemblies, including their performance during a fire, design criteria, installation guidelines, and maintenance procedures By adhering to these requirements, building owners and operators can have confidence that their fire curtains will perform as intended in an emergency.

One of the key requirements of BS 8524 is the performance of fire curtains during a fire Fire curtains must be able to withstand high temperatures and intense heat for a specified period, typically 30 minutes or more, to contain the fire and protect escape routes They should also maintain their integrity and not allow the passage of flames or hot gases to the other side Additionally, fire curtains must be capable of blocking radiant heat to protect occupants and firefighters during evacuation and rescue operations.

Fire curtains must be designed to fit specific openings and configurations in the building, ensuring that they can deploy effectively and seal off the fire area The standard specifies the maximum size of openings that a fire curtain can protect, as well as requirements for the materials used in its construction, such as fire-resistant fabrics, controls, and fixings.

Installation guidelines are also an essential part of BS 8524 to ensure that fire curtains are correctly fitted and positioned for optimal performance Fire curtains should be installed by trained and competent personnel following the manufacturer’s instructions and guidelines Proper installation is crucial to ensuring that the fire curtain deploys smoothly and seals off the fire area quickly and effectively Regular maintenance and testing are also required to ensure that the fire curtain remains in good working condition and ready to deploy in an emergency.
